Output 4e2588612fdb5361009196d869f90451782c51bdd063db5a6c6ee39a14064300:17

value
66984910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d75c357912ee245346176f9472294b1f7e9962 OP_EQUAL
address
MDp1UCJgd2upSYqSxbTWZjXnucB2DLPC6y
transaction
4e2588612fdb5361009196d869f90451782c51bdd063db5a6c6ee39a14064300
spent
true